BOWLING GREEN — Nate Needham will have his shot at pro football with the Las Vegas Raiders.
The former Bowling Green State University place-kicker has earned an invite to join Las Vegas’ minicamp, after surging among college football kickers last season.
Needham was named a first-team All-American by the Football Writers Association of America after turning in a career-defining year for the Falcons.
Needham was Bowling Green’s Mr. Automatic in converting 19 of 20 field goal attempts. He made 12 of 13 from 40-plus yards and converted on both tries from 50-plus yards.
He was named a semifinalist for the Lou Groza Award, which is awarded annually to college football’s best place-kicker.
